Ferrexpo plc (LON:FXPO – Get Free Report) was up 10.8% on Saturday . The stock traded as high as GBX 61.90 ($0.83) and last traded at GBX 59.40 ($0.80). Approximately 8,940,306 shares were traded during trading, an increase of 135% from the average daily volume of 3,802,694 shares. The stock had previously closed at GBX 53.60 ($0.72).
Ferrexpo Stock Performance
The stock has a fifty day simple moving average of GBX 54 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of GBX 53.06.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.33, a quick ratio of 2.20 and a current ratio of 2.11. The stock has a market cap of £349.51 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-1.16, a P/E/G ratio of -0.18 and a beta of 1.26.
About Ferrexpo
Ferrexpo’s operations have been supplying the global steel industry for over 50 years, and in 2022 the Group produced 6.1 million tonnes of iron ore pellets, despite the war in Ukraine.
